Here is a run down of my favorite sites to visit and use: (some of these sites you need Adobe to download the PDF of the worksheets)

Enchanted Learning: (you can visit that site by clicking of the button my right side bar) This site has member and non-members. The non-members can still print many pages for free, but some are not accessible. For site members (of which I am), you pay $20 a year or $36 for two years and there are no restrictions of where you can go and what you can print out. I am a believer in free stuff, but I use this site weekly and I find the money is well worth it. However, it is more of a main stream site, so you will find articles about evolution woven throughout. Filter where and as needed.

 Super Teacher Worksheets: I use this site for the children’s spellings lists and some math worksheets. I also like it for the kindergarten stuff. It has all grade levels and all the subjects you will need. This site is totally free.

TLS Books: This site is another good one for all subjects and all grades. It is totally free, as well.

incompeTECH: This is a site that has free different kinds graph paper.

Hand writing: This is a nice to site to use to make your own hand writing practice worksheets. It has print D’Nealian, and cursive styles.  These worksheets are free.
